The Property Insurance Section of The Federation of Defense & Corporate Counsel (FDCC) and the Property Loss Research Bureau (PLRB) will jointly sponsor a conference for senior insurance executives and lawyers on cutting-edge issues currently faced by high-level first party property insurance executives. The one-day conference, entitled “Critical Issues for Senior Property Insurance Executives and In-House Counsel,” will take place on Oct. 28 at the Renaissance Hotel in Chicago.
In addition to its “Business Interruption Forum” and presentation on “Special Causation Issues, Ensuing Loss and Mold Claims,” the program will include a review of recent case law from across the country, explore the attorney-client privilege and discovery issues in property litigation, and provide pointers for handling claims for loss of electronic data and reinsuring property losses.
Faculty members include Mark Feinberg, Douglas Houser, Jacqueline Jauregui, Steven Pate, Janet Brown, John McCabe, Michael Schroder, Marvin Karp, Stephen Goldman, Thomas Brown, Alan Miller, Norman Sade and Mitchell Orpett. All are nationally recognized property insurance lawyers in private practice and are FDCC members. Stephen Goldman, a Vice-President of the FDCC, will chair the event.
